I have recently finished reading a novel by an American lady - Richelle Elberg - she was offering her novel "Impunity" as a kindle freebee a month or so back as part of her marketing campaign. So many self-published books nowadays are poorly written, have too linear stories and leave you feeling cheated of time, this is NOT one of those.

 

Let me ask you a question: What would you do?

 

Faced with a crashed money truck in the middle of nowhere, its doors burst open at the rear, and there, before you, millions of dollars in easily portable sacks. Would you take some? Who’d know?

 

This is how Impunity starts. A wonderfully engaging beginning to a book. It makes you ask yourself what would you do in the same situation. I for one would probably do the same as the principle characters. I won’t go into any more detail concerning the consequences as this would spoil your read, however I will say it’s worth your time.

 

When I first began reading I thought this book would be similar to Scott Smith’s “A Simple Plan”. No it isn’t. Although the initial premise of finding a stack of cash is similar, Impunity is a far better book. All in all a superiorly crafted piece of work. It is written in a much more engaging style, it flows with more pace and has deeper more believable characters. I particularly liked the bad-guy back story and how it weaved into the main narrative, creating tension and a feeling of anxiety for the main players.

 

An excellent novel and highly recommended.
